The claisen condensation reaction Esters, like aldehydes and ketones,are weakly acidic. When an ester with an alpha hydrogen is treated with one equivalent of a base such as sodium ethoxide, a reversible condensation reaction occurs to yield a p-keto ester product. This reaction between two ester components is known as the Claisen condensation reaction
